
uring the fall of 2002, Don Smith, former Missouri City Councilman, organized residents and committed business and civic leaders in Missouri City, Texas, who wanted to bring an event of purpose and substance to their community. As a result of that collaboration, the Missouri City Juneteenth Celebration Foundation was founded.

The five days of family oriented, educational, and cultural events are all free, thanks to the contributions and support of community oriented companies who understand the importance of supporting the customers they serve.
Presently, in its third year, the MCJCF scholarship fund provides financial support to deserving students. Scholarship recipients attend Baylor University, Stephen F. Austin, Prairie View A&M University, University of Missouri – Columbia, and The University of Texas.
This year the Missouri City Juneteenth celebration will include the inaugural Health and Wellness Fair, which will offer screening for the major causes of mortality of African Americans.
